Security in Art: How Paintings and Sculptures Depict Security and Surveillance

Art has long been a medium for exploring and expressing complex themes of security and surveillance. Artists from different eras, using various forms of art such as paintings, sculptures, films, and installations, have delved into the nuances of safety, control, and surveillance. Their works often serve as a critical lens, inviting viewers to reflect on the balance between protection and privacy invasion. Artistic expressions in this realm challenge perceptions, ignite dialogue, and foster a broader societal conversation on the implications of security and surveillance systems. Through art, complex ideas about power, privacy, and freedom are brought into focus, providing a unique perspective on the delicate balance of maintaining safety while respecting individual liberties.
